### Action Item: Spoolhaven Retry Storm

From last Tuesday's outage: the Spoolhaven print service retried failed jobs without backoff, saturating the render pool. Fix merged; retries now use capped exponential backoff with jitter. Owner will monitor for a week before closing. The agreed retry constants are recorded below.

constants for yadup-kajof:
RATE_LIMITS = {
    "zorwyn": 1,
    "druwyn": 1,
}

## Marrowgate Retail Pilot — Overview (Managers Only)

Sales leads should familiarize themselves with the ongoing pilot with the Marrowgate retail chain, covering five stores in the Ellsworth district. The pilot tests our Fenwick inventory-sync module under live conditions. Preliminary data shows improved stock accuracy and reduced order errors, though checkout integration required two patches. A full evaluation report is due at quarter's end. The confidential planning note for managers is appended below.

confidential, fahag-yahap: Project Raleth slips by six weeks because of the tooling delay.

Subject: Handover — PedalShift rebalancing database

Hi Annika,

Welcome to the team. The PedalShift rebalancer reads station occupancy every five minutes and writes suggested truck routes to the `moves` table. Please note the optimizer is sensitive to replica lag, so always verify replication health before a rebalancing run. Schema migrations live in the `db/` folder and must be applied in order. The primary instance is reachable using the connection string below.

primary connection of tajeg-tajop = postgresql://julax_svc:DI@db-e7f3.kelvidyn.corp:5432/rusdor

### Step 4: Repoint the encode workers

After draining jobs from the legacy Brindlecast farm, update each transcode worker to target the new Quillfork scheduler before restarting. Do not restart workers in bulk; stagger them in groups of five so in-flight renders can finish. Support agents should verify the dashboard shows zero stuck jobs first. Each worker must then be restarted with the following configuration values.

service settings:
[casax]
port = 6379
team = rusir
host = casax.zemvarhq.corp
region = outer-4
access_code = ac_9808ce
timeout_ms = 1500